Understanding Telugu Voice Process Jobs

Telugu voice process jobs function primarily as a customer service role, where communication is key to solving queries, providing assistance, and facilitating transactions. These jobs are popular in various sectors including telecommunication, customer service, technical support, and more. Given the rapid digitization, the need for effective Telugu communication skills has amplified, offering ample opportunities for the talented workforce.

Why Telugu Voice Process Jobs?

The growth of regional language services across various industries is evident. With a thriving community of Telugu speakers, providing support in their native language enhances customer satisfaction. Companies aim to offer personalized services, which is a critical differentiator in customer retention strategy. This opens up a vast job market for individuals proficient in Telugu, making voice process jobs lucrative and promising. Let's delve into the key do's and don'ts to succeed in this field.

The Do's for Success in Telugu Voice Process Jobs

1. Mastering the Language

Proficiency in Telugu is non-negotiable. Be it grammar, vocabulary, or pronunciation, fluency in the language is your primary tool. Ensure you continuously work on expanding your Telugu vocabulary and perfecting your grammar.

2. Active Listening

Actively listen to what the customer is saying. It’s critical not only to understand the context but also to pick up on emotional cues. This will help in addressing concerns accurately and efficiently.

3. Clarity and Conciseness

Communicate clearly and concisely. Avoid the use of heavy jargon as it can confuse the listener. Break down complex instructions into simpler steps.

4. Stay Updated

The business landscape and customer needs are constantly evolving. Keep yourself updated with the latest developments in your sector, product information, and customer service techniques.

5. Patience and Empathy

Demonstrate patience and empathy in your interactions. Understanding the customer's point of view can greatly enhance the rapport and customer experience you offer.

The Don'ts of Telugu Voice Process Jobs

1. Avoiding Assumptions

Never make assumptions about what the customer is experiencing. Always ask questions to clearly understand the issue before offering solutions.

2. Overloading with Information

Avoid overwhelming customers with too much information at once. Stick to what is necessary for solving their issue or answering their query. This maintains focus and clarity.

3. Ignoring Feedback

Feedback from customers is invaluable. Do not ignore it. Use it to adapt and improve your service delivery.

4. Lack of Follow-up

Never let a query go unresolved. Always ensure there is a follow-up action to reassure the customer that their needs are being attended to.

5. Being Defensive

When confronted with criticism or a difficult customer, avoid being defensive. Stay calm, and offer constructive solutions instead of justifying or arguing.

Developing Essential Skills

A successful career in Telugu voice process jobs isn't just about language proficiency. It also includes honing skills in areas such as:

  • Problem-solving: Developing quick and efficient solutions.
  • Technical Expertise: Understanding the tools and systems in use.
  • Interpersonal Skills: Building relationships with customers.
  • Time Management: Efficient handling of calls and tasks to maximize productivity.

Technology and Tools

Familiarize yourself with the technology and tools commonly used in voice process jobs. This might include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software, ticketing systems, and more. Efficiently using these tools will enhance your performance and service delivery.

Building a Career Path

Explore opportunities for growth within your organization or the industry. Develop competencies and take initiative for professional development to advance in your career. This could involve taking up additional responsibilities, undergoing training, or coaching new hires. Recognize that voice process jobs can be a stepping stone to managerial or specialized roles with dedication and effort.
